A partir de la premisa de la separabilidad del contrato y del acuerdo de arbitraje, el presente estudio aborda, desde una perspectiva comparada, la determinación de la ley aplicable a la validez del acuerdo de arbitraje en las transacciones internacionales. Se deslinda a estos efectos la validez formal y la validez sustancial, se pone de relieve la divergencia de las distintas aproximaciones existentes a tales cuestiones en las legislaciones nacionales y en los reglamentos institucionales y se delimita el ámbito de aplicación de la ley rectora de la validez formal y sustancial de los acuerdos de arbitraje.
Based on the premise of separability of the contract and the arbitration agreement, this article deals with the determination of the law applicable to the validity of arbitration agreements in cross-border transactions. A distinction is made between formal validity and substantial validity. Divergences among national legislations and institutional regulations are also highlighted. Finally, the sphere of application of the law governing both formal and substantial validity is delimited.
